Output eba57131a93b795d77402b57c02cfbbe3d992f5733631c5c6c0ece27b42496bf:3

value
323520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1679b7d1d9e4368eff795c189f57d8581c25df25 OP_EQUAL
address
33jrbt7fw5d992mVNo3qd5qJqf4MNbkLoh
transaction
eba57131a93b795d77402b57c02cfbbe3d992f5733631c5c6c0ece27b42496bf
spent
true